Question
The sum of three numbers is 130. If the ratio of
smallest number to largest number is 1:6, and that of smallest number to second smallest number is 1:3, then find the largest number.Solution
Let the smallest number be 'x' So, second smallest number = 3x And largest number = x × 6 = 6x ATQ: 3x + 6x + x = 130 Or,
10x = 130 So,
x = 13 So, largest number = 13 × 6 = 78
